> >2) Sendmail is not working. When I instaleld Debian 1.2 it
> >auto-installed Smail, I then used dselect to install Sendmail but
> >Sendmail doesn't work.
>
> Very often, sendmail is running as a daemon, and smail is running from
> inetd. Maybe that's causing your problems. But.. what isn't sendmail doing
> exactly?
I get the following error when I try to send mail to 'dmk'
Jan 14 09:46:45 icehouse sendmail[770]: JAA00770: from=dmk, size=262,
class=0, pri=30262, nrcpts=1,
msgid=<199701141446.JAA00770@icehouse.nwdc.com>, relay=dmk@localhost
Jan 14 09:46:46 icehouse sendmail[772]: JAA00770: to=dmk, ctladdr=dmk
(501/100), delay=00:00:01, xdelay=00:00:01, mailer=nullclient,
relay=none, stat=Host unknown (Name server: none: host not found)
Jan 14 09:46:46 icehouse sendmail[772]: JAA00770: JAA00772: DSN: Host
unknown (Name server: none: host not found)
Jan 14 09:46:46 icehouse sendmail[775]: JAA00772: to=dmk, delay=00:00:00,
xdelay=00:00:00, mailer=nullclient, relay=none, stat=Host unknown (Name
server: none:
host not found)
Jan 14 09:46:46 icehouse sendmail[775]: JAA00772: JAA00775: return to
sender: Host unknown (Name server: none: host not found)
Jan 14 09:46:46 icehouse sendmail[775]: Saved message in /var/tmp/dead.letter
Jan 14 09:46:46 icehouse sendmail[777]: JAA00775: to=postmaster,
delay=00:00:00, xdelay=00:00:00, mailer=nullclient, relay=none, stat=Host
unknown (Name server: none: host not found)
I never receive anything.
